If Caldwell was feeling good fresh off their 47-9 takedown of Ontario on Friday, their most recent game may have dampened their spirits a bit. The Cougars were dealt a 47-15 loss at the hands of the Wood River Wolverines on Saturday. Unfortunately, that's the second time they've come up short against the Wolverines this season, as they also lost their prior matchup 41-28 back in November.
Caldwell's defeat shouldn't obscure the performances of Yesenia Montanez, who posted seven points and four steals, and Yazmeen Montanez, who scored no points.
Caldwell has also been struggling recently as they've lost four of their last five matchups. That's put a noticeable dent in their 2-7 record this season. As for Wood River, their victory bumped their record up to 5-2.
Caldwell and Wood River will both get a bit of extra prep time before their next games. The next time the Cougars see the court they'll take on Skyview at 7:00 p.m. on January 6, 2026. As for Wood River, their break will end when they face Buhl at 7:30 p.m. on January 5, 2026.
